How much does it cost to rent a home in Edgewater?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Edgewater 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,935 | $1,950 | $9,500 |
Edgewater 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,444 | $2,400 | $9,245 |
Edgewater 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,022 | $3,500 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Edgewater
What type of rentals are currently available in Edgewater?
There are currently 8677 Apartments for Rent in Edgewater, NJ with pricing that ranges from $650 to $36,460. There are also 753 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Edgewater ranging from $1,600 to $25,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Edgewater?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Edgewater ranges from $1,600 to $25,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,183.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Edgewater?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Edgewater range from $1,225 to $36,460,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,400 to $9,245.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,500 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,150.
